Knowledge Points: Understanding AED Access
Automated External Defibrillators (AEDs) are crucial for treating sudden cardiac arrest. Access to these devices, coupled with prompt action, dramatically increases survival rates. This app aims to bridge the gap between emergencies and readily available AEDs.

Insight Aspects: Community Contribution
A critical insight involves the potential for community contribution. Is the app reliant on a centralized database, or does it allow users to add and update AED locations? Crowdsourcing can significantly improve the comprehensiveness and accuracy of the map.
Wisdom suggests that a collaborative approach, where users can contribute and verify AED locations, creates a more resilient and reliable resource.
